About the Role:
Are you an occupational therapist looking for a new opportunity? Join an established and industry leading private practice, supporting the community across the lifespan, with a passionate, supportive and dynamic team. We are a teaching clinic, so have a variety of team members at various stages of their careers, which builds strong learning and dynamic energy throughout our team.
We work in a collaborative manner, engaging with carers and parents, educators, and other allied health professionals, from a wide variety of referral sources. Referrals are accepted across the lifespan – for children from the age of 2 years, through childhood and adolescence, and throughout adulthood. We work out of two clinics (Yarra Junction and Warragul), as well as providing community based support (e.g. home, school, kinder, aged care), and offering Telehealth coaching and intervention that can be done in the clinic or Work From Home.
